Traffic and Tantrums (Almost)

Parramatta Road on any given evening, about 5pm, is an absolute nightmare. It doesn't discriminate. Weekday and weekends, it is fairly consistent. Absolute nightmare!

I found myself smack bang in the middle of one of these joyous traffic 5pm specials one weekend. We were crawling towards the M4. Baby steps. One roll forward, two kilometres back... You get the gist. I had two bordering on cranky kids in the car. I was stuck in a jam. What do I do? I started speaking in my Valley Girl accent. 

For the next 15 mins I took on the role of a Valley Girl to keep them entertained. 

"Oh my gahd why is there, like, so much traffic?" I shrilled suddenly as Tata was about to burst out into a whinge attack because I apparently did not buy the lolly she wanted from the store "back there"... Wherever "there" was. I do not have a clue because apparently I should not ask because I know. I don't. Really.

"So, like, if you're totally good, you totally get, like, some candy okay?" I said, this new persona possessed me. 

"Um, okay" Tata agreed surprised, her tears forgotten. 

Toto was laughing gaily in his seat. 

"Mummy!" He gasped in between laughter. "You sound real!"

"Uh hell-ooooo?" I cried out, continuing on with this crazy accent. "Like, euwwwww, I'm totally real! Can't you see, like, I'm totally human. Like. You know?"

They laughed and continued to talk to Valley Girl. I was having a blast. After I drove for about a maximum of 1 kilometre, I gave up fighting the traffic and turned into Burwood. 

"Detour kids," I said in my normal voice. "We're having Tim Ho Wan baked buns for dinner."

"Mummy where is the other voice?" Tata asked, disappointed my accent was gone.

"Mummy is hungry," I replied. "The voice has to rest."

"That was cool mummy," Toto chuckled.

"Cool!" Tata agreed, her face beaming. 

I smiled smugly to myself as I drove into Westfield. I was cool. They thought their mum was cool. Even for just half the length of that atrocity we call Parramatta Road. 

Well, like, give me a high five, okay? 😉😋
